The Benefits of Using an Exercise Bike
Exercise bikes provide numerous benefits for physical fitness lovers and novices alike. Here are some crucial advantages:

Cardiovascular Health: Regular cycling reinforces the heart and enhances blood circulation, minimizing the threat of cardiovascular disease.

Low Impact: Unlike running or aerobics, cycling is low-impact, making it easier on the joints. This quality makes it an exceptional choice for individuals recuperating from injury or those with arthritis.

Weight Management: Cycling can burn a significant variety of calories, helping in weight loss when combined with a balanced diet plan.

Muscle Toning: Riding an exercise bike works various muscle groups, especially in the lower body, consisting of the quads, hamstrings, and calves.

Convenience: mini exercise cycle bikes are perfect for home exercises. They take up less space than treadmills and can be utilized at any time of day, despite weather.

Inspiration: Many mini cycle exercise bike bikes come geared up with features that assist track performance, such as distance took a trip, calories burned, and heart rate, offering inspiration and responsibility.

There are numerous types of exercise bikes to pick from, each created for different fitness goals and preferences. Below are the most typical types:
1. Upright Bikes
Upright bikes resemble standard bikes. They need the rider to keep an upright posture, which engages core muscles together with the legs. These bikes are best for those looking for a standard cycling experience.
2. Recumbent Bikes
Recumbent bikes have a larger seat with back assistance, enabling a more unwinded posture. This design decreases stress on the back and joints, making it appropriate for seniors or those with lower back issues.
3. Spin Bikes
Spin bikes are developed for high-intensity indoor biking exercises. They feature a heavy flywheel and adjustable resistance, enabling users to replicate road biking and carry out intense interval training.
4. Folding Bikes
Folding stationary bicycle are ideal for those with minimal area. These bikes can be easily folded up and stored when not in use, making them perfect for smaller sized homes or apartments.

Choosing the right stationary bicycle can be frustrating provided the variety of choices offered. Here are some aspects to think about:

Comfort: Ensure the bike has an adjustable seat and handlebars to provide a comfy riding experience.

Space Availability: Measure the space where you prepare to keep the bike. If area is limited, consider a folding model.

Resistance Levels: Look for bikes with adjustable resistance to boost your workout strength as you advance.

Display Features: A clear monitor showing your speed, range, time, and heart rate can be really motivating.

Spending plan: Exercise bikes come in a variety of costs. Set a spending plan that aligns with your physical fitness objectives and adhere to it.

Warranty and Support: Consider the maker's warranty and consumer support when making your selection.
